Public sceptical over Labour's 10-year plan

ALMOST half of people think government plans to improve the health of the nation will make no difference, or make it harder to see a GP.
More than four in 10 also believe the 10-year plan will not improve waiting times in A&E, a survey has revealed.
However, the overwhelming majority back the creation of neighbourhood health centres, the expansion of the NHS app and more mental health support in schools and colleges. The health plan was unveiled by Prime Minister Sir Keir Starmer this month to bring care much closer to people's homes, reducing the reliance on hospitals and A&E.
Key reforms include an enhanced NHS app, giving patients more control over their care, new neighbourhood health centres open six days a week and at least 12 hours a day, and new laws on food and alcohol to prevent ill health.
A survey of 1,023 adults, conducted by Ipsos, asked people how they think the plan will impact access to healthcare, such as getting a GP appointment, A&E waiting times and waits for routine hospital treatment.
Some 35% said the plan will have no impact on getting a GP appointment, while 14% believe it will make things harder.
This compares with the 29% of people who said they think it will make getting an appointment easier.
